Kehr's sign
From WikiLectures
Pain and hypoaesthesia in the left shoulder (most often above the left shoulder blade) caused by irritation of the nervus phrenicus with blood in the diaphragm area. It is most often observed during splenic rupture, more rarely it can also be caused by oviduct rupture during tubal pregnancy.
